Walton County Public Works Update
Walton County – May 5, 2025 – Walton County Public Works is pleased to announce the progress of several critical infrastructure projects currently being performed by in-house crews.
Among the latest developments:
Yorkey Road Resurfacing Project
Our asphalt crew has done a commendable job finishing the overlay on Mathews Road. They are now focusing their efforts on overlaying the milled asphalt on Yorkey Road.
Karli Court Dirt-to-Pave Project
The transition of Karli Court from a dirt road to a paved surface is well underway. Key improvements are being made to the drainage system, which will support better water flow and reduce potential flooding.
Paxton Senior Center Retention Pond
We’ve successfully completed the groundwork on the retention pond. In the meantime, we are waiting for the material to arrive to construct the Baffle.
Grady Brown Park Pilings
Crews are mobilizing at Grady Brown Park to install about 75 pilings that will be used as fixed points to secure boats along the north and south retaining seawalls.
Forest Shore Road Drainage Improvements
Work is progressing on enhancing the drainage system along Forest Shore Road. These improvements are crucial for reducing flood risks and promoting more effective water management, benefiting both residents and the local ecosystem.
S. Norwood Road Sidewalk
We are making steady progress on the new sidewalk along South Norwood Road. This development is intended to improve pedestrian accessibility and safety, providing a secure pathway for walkers and contributing to the walkability of the community.
Road Striping Projects
Our paint crew is working diligently to stripe Mathews Road. We will be moving to Yorkey Road soon.
